SurveySparrow
Contact
1633 W Innovation Way,
5th Floor,
Lehi - 84043,
utah,
United States of America
admin@surveysparrow.com
+1 (800) 481-0410
Skip to:
1633 W Innovation Way,
5th Floor,
Lehi - 84043,
utah,
United States of America
admin@surveysparrow.com
+1 (800) 481-0410
Copyright © 2025 Atlassian